Elementary School Districts | Apache Elementary School District #42

Provides academic education for students in kindergarten through grade 8 in a one-room classroom. Operates on a four-day school week. Homeless Education Liaison provides assistance to school-age youth who do not have a permanent place of residence. Services include school enrollment, transportation to and from school, free breakfast and lunch programs, and other support services. Also provides information about additional resources in the community. Provides support services for students with disabilities.
